    Different weeks of the year have corresponding flowers, similar to birthstones. Principles contains more concerning the purpose of this thing. January is the snowdrop and carnation; February the primrose and violet; March the violet and jonquil; April flowers are the daisy and lovely pea; May represents lily of the valley and hawthorn; June is the flower and honeysuckle; July the water lily and larkspur; August represents the gladiolus and poppy; September the Morning Glory and Aster; October the Marigold; November, chrysanthemum; and December birthdays the Poinsettia and Holly.
